Rachel Clarke was born in 1778 in Dutchess County, New York, USA, the child of Isaac Clarke And Mary Lawrie. In 1851, Rachel Clarke resided in Northumberland, Canada West (Ontario), Canada. Rachel Clarke married Jeremiah Herrington, and had children including Charles Herrington, Charlotte Ann Herrington, Jacob Herrington, James Herrington, Jane Herrington Kemp, Jeremiah Herrington, John C Herrington, Lucinda Sarah Herrington Montgomery, Margaret Herrington, Moses Herrington, Phoebe Phebe Anne Herrington, Sarah Ann Herrington, Vestra Herrington, William H Herrington. Rachel Clarke passed away in 1860 in Carman, Northumberland County, Ontario, Canada.
